19 ft Celebrity Removal in Waco, TX

A 19 ft Celebrity 190 bowrider showed up in a driveway in Waco with no windshield and a hull full of rainwater. The trailer had flat tires on both sides, and the boat had been sitting there long enough that nobody could remember when it arrived. The owner had moved to Robinson years back and left the rig behind. No title in the drawer, handled per the Texas rules. We got the call from a neighbor tired of looking at it. The flat tires meant we couldn't roll it out, so we brought a hydraulic lift to set the trailer on air and take the weight off the rubber. Once that was done, we could move it. The crew got the boat loaded under an hour, drained what water we could, and routed the hull to the processor for recycling.
